Chains are illegal in all levels below college technically. Some umps enforce it and some do not. There are only a few players in the game that ACTUALLY slow the pace of play down enough to matter between pitches and it is typically counteracted by pitchers who take less than average time between pitches. Surely it cant be that big of a deal whether or not someones cap bill is straight of curved...
Shortening the game is all well and good but if you shorten the game you always take away the essence of baseball.
When the game gets shortened it decreases the number of pitches thrown in a game. If you reduce number of pitches you allow for a single pitcher to dominate a game which in turn takes away a lot of those chances for late inning comebacks and lessening the value of a complete game being thrown by a single pitcher. This in turn waters down how good guys like Nolan Ryan and Sandy Koufax really were (for all you traditionalist out there). You also take the role of relief pitcher/ pinch hitter/ defensive replacements out of the game entirely. Now less kids can play in the game and we all know that NO parent will stand for their baby not making the team. Over time the game of baseball loses more and more kids to Lacrosse and Commie ball ( soccer ) because more kids get a chance to play and Americas pass time becomes extinct.
Its an endless paradox of mayhem that would change the game in more ways than just Time!!
